Mike Smith: Education and Certifications
Mike Smith holds a bachelor's degree in computer science and mathematics from Virginia Tech. He has further enhanced his qualifications with certifications in data analytics from the University of Delaware and in inclusion and diversity leadership from Cornell University. Additionally, Mike is a Certified Compensation Professional (CCP), demonstrating his expertise in compensation management and strategy.
Mike Smith: Professional Background
Prior to his current role, Mike Smith has held significant positions at Freddie Mac and Capital One. Mike Smith: Industry Board Involvements
Mike Smith is an active member of several industry boards. He serves on the client advisory board for Fidelity Investments, where he offers insights and expertise on human resources trends and strategies. Mike Smith: Community Engagement
In addition to his professional achievements, Mike Smith is dedicated to community service. He is a board member of the Boys & Girls Clubs of Delaware and chairs the board's HR committee.
